Next-generation valve that reduces operational variation and improves sealing performance.
This service valve adopts a new joint method using a compression fitting instead of a flare nut, which is prone to variations in work. The tightening process is completed when the gap between the nut and the body is eliminated, allowing anyone to easily perform the task. After the work is completed, checking for gaps ensures that the work was done correctly. Additionally, there is no need for lap flare processing during connection, which helps to reduce work deficiencies and variations, thereby eliminating refrigerant leaks caused by construction errors.

basic information
1. Reliable Metal Compression Seal As the tightening nut is tightened, the metal ferrule compresses against the outer circumference of the copper pipe to create a seal. The compression point with the copper pipe is large, providing stable sealing performance. 2. Permanent Joint Structure The outer circumference of the fixed nut is cylindrical, making it difficult to loosen a joint once it has been tightened. We aim to achieve a joint that meets European standards for permanent joints. 3. No Torque Management Required During Connection The connection is complete once the tightening nut is tightened and there is no gap between the fixed nut and the valve. There is no need to manage torque, allowing anyone to connect easily and reliably. 4. No Need for Flare Processing There is no need for flare processing during installation. This reduces concerns about refrigerant leaks due to variations in work or mistakes. 5. Temporary Fixing Function for Copper Pipe After inserting the copper pipe, it can be temporarily fixed by hand-tightening the tightening nut. There is no worry about the piping coming loose until the installation is complete, and there is no need for marking, etc. 6. Ferrule Loss Prevention The ferrule is assembled to the fixed nut to prevent loss. Therefore, there is no concern about damaging or losing the ferrule.
